Web geliştiricisi , hem görsel olarak çekici hem de işlevsel web siteleri oluşturmak için çeşitli programlama dilleri ve yazılım araçları kullanan uzmandır
Web geliştiricisinin bazı görevleri :
Web geliştirme, üç ana kategoriye ayrılır:
Web geliştirme için okunabilecek bazı kitaplar: HTML & CSS - Jon Duckett. Dreaming in Code - Scott Rosenberg. Web Tasarım Rehberi - KODLAB Yayıncılık. Web Tasarım Temelleri - Musa Çiçek. Code Complete: A Practical Handbook of Software Construction - Steve McConnell. Kitap seçimi, kişinin bilgi seviyesine ve ilgi alanlarına göre değişiklik gösterebilir.
Site geliştirme uzmanının (web tasarım uzmanı veya tam yığın geliştirici gibi farklı unvanlarla da anılabilir) bazı görevleri şunlardır: Web sitesi tasarımı ve geliştirme. İçerik yönetimi. SEO ve mobil uyumluluk. Güvenlik. API entegrasyonu. Test ve optimizasyon. Müşteri iletişimi. Site geliştirme uzmanları, serbest olarak veya dijital pazarlama ajansları, web tasarım firmaları gibi çeşitli sektörlerde çalışabilir.
Web programlamada ele alınan bazı konular: HTML, CSS ve JavaScript. PHP, Java, ASP.NET. Veritabanı işlemleri. Front-end ve back-end kavramları. İnternet ve sunucu sistemleri. Domain ve hosting.
Web geliştirici olmak için alınması gereken bazı dersler: HTML, CSS, JavaScript ve diğer programlama dilleri. Veritabanı tasarımı ve yönetimi. Kullanıcı deneyimi (UX) ve kullanılabilirlik ilkeleri. Front-end ve back-end web geliştirme. Problem çözme ve hata ayıklama. Web geliştirme eğitimi, bilgisayar bilimi veya ilgili bir alanda lisans eğitimi ile alınabileceği gibi, çevrimiçi kurslar yoluyla da sağlanabilir.
Web tabanlı yazılım, internet üzerinden erişilebilen ve kullanılan yazılım uygulamalarıdır. Başlıca işlevleri: Erişilebilirlik. Kurulum gerektirmez. Güncellemeler ve bakım. Çapraz platform uyumluluğu. Kullanım alanları: İş yönetimi ve üretkenlik. Müşteri ilişkileri yönetimi (CRM). E-ticaret. Eğitim ve e-öğrenme. Finans ve muhasebe.
Web editörü, web sitelerinde yayınlanacak içeriklerin oluşturulması, düzenlenmesi ve yönetilmesinden sorumludur. Temel görevleri şunlardır: 1. İçerik Üretimi: Makaleler, blog gönderileri, ürün açıklamaları ve basın bültenleri gibi web tabanlı içerikler yazmak. 2. Mevcut İçeriği Gözden Geçirme: Şirket standartlarına ve doğruluk kurallarına uygunluğunu kontrol etmek. 3. Yazar ve Tasarımcılarla İşbirliği: İçeriklerin dil bilgisi ve stil yönergelerine uygun olmasını sağlamak için yazarlarla çalışmak ve tasarımcılarla tasarım unsurları üzerinde işbirliği yapmak. 4. SEO Optimizasyonu: Web trafiğinin artırılabileceği alanları belirlemek ve içeriklerin arama motoru optimizasyonuna uygun olmasını sağlamak. 5. İçerik Güncellemeleri: Web sayfalarını düzenli olarak güncellemek ve içerik oluşturma çabalarını koordine etmek. Web editörleri, ayrıca sosyal medya pazarlaması ve dijital medya stratejileri konusunda da bilgi sahibi olabilirler.
Web programlamanın temelleri iki ana bileşenden oluşur: istemci tarafı (frontend) ve sunucu tarafı (backend) programlama. İstemci tarafı programlama (frontend), kullanıcının doğrudan etkileşimde bulunduğu web sayfasının tasarımı ve kullanıcı arayüzü ile ilgilidir. Bu alanda kullanılan başlıca diller ve teknolojiler şunlardır: HTML (HyperText Markup Language): Web sayfalarının temel yapısını oluşturur. CSS (Cascading Style Sheets): HTML ile oluşturulan yapıların stilize edilmesini sağlar. JavaScript: Web sayfalarına dinamik ve etkileşimli özellikler ekler. Sunucu tarafı programlama (backend), web sitesinin arka planda çalışan kısmını kapsar ve veri işleme, depolama ve iş mantığı gibi işlevleri içerir. Bu alanda yaygın olarak kullanılan programlama dilleri şunlardır: PHP: Dinamik web sayfaları oluşturmak için yaygın olarak kullanılır. Python: Django ve Flask gibi güçlü çerçevelere sahiptir. Ruby: Ruby on Rails gibi popüler çerçevelerle web geliştirme işlemlerini kolaylaştırır. Java: Güvenilir ve ölçeklenebilir web uygulamaları geliştirmek için kullanılır. Node.js: JavaScript’in sunucu tarafında çalışmasına olanak tanır.
Teknoloji
Windows 10 oyunu tam ekran yapma nasıl yapılır?
Web geliştirme ne iş yapar?
Vodafone Türkiye 5G'yi nerede test ediyor?
WD harici harddisk ne kadar güvenli?
Uygulama simgelerinde ok işareti neden çıkar?
Veri girişi için hangi modül kullanılır?
Uzaktan Sağlık Bilgi Sistemi (USBS) nedir?
Whirlpool hangi markanın yan ürünü?
WebSocket bağlantısı neden kesilir?
Welder kaliteli bir marka mı?
Windows 10 güncelleme nasıl yapılır?
WhatsApp müşteri hizmetleri ile nasıl konuşabilirim?
Uzak masaüstü bağlantısı için hangi program kullanılır?
Vozol 50K kaç gün gider?
VK Skype'a nasıl bağlanır?
WhatsApp Web'de görüntülü konuşma var mı?
UYAP intranet nedir?
USB ile bilgisayara bağlanan telefon nasıl görülür?
VK'da video kalitesi nasıl arttırılır?
Viessmann kombi resetleme nasıl yapılır?
Vega e-fatura nasıl izlenir?
WhatsApp'ta kanallara kimler katılabilir?
V1 ve V2 hızı nedir?
VSM yöntemi nedir?
WhatsApp kayıtlı adlar nerede?
VK katıl özelliği nedir?
Uydu alıcılı TV ile smart TV arasındaki fark nedir?
VKontakte Arapçada nasıl kullanılır?
WhatsApp görüntülü konuşmada ses neden eko yapar?
Windows 10 Enterprise LTSB ve LTSC arasındaki fark nedir?
Vms uygulaması ücretli mi?
Vantage Point ne işe yarar?
Varsayılan tarayıcı nasıl değiştirilir?
VoIP kullanmak güvenli mi?
Vestel Android TV Google hesabı nasıl açılır?
VHF frekans aralığı kaç?
WhatsApp'ta arşivlenen sohbet silinir mi?
Uyds.yds.gov.tr nedir?
UYAP cep telefonu doğrulama nasıl yapılır?
VUK507 hangi cihazları kapsıyor?